Transaction 77f962259019f70af86f180bf8f153c6c11d73019a44dbb8a5bb4151688e9e99

4 Input
2 Outputs
  • 77f962259019f70af86f180bf8f153c6c11d73019a44dbb8a5bb4151688e9e99:0
  • value  10931992
    address  1MRZPYVjEuuCirokWr9uAqdLA5yxSqWMXm
  • 77f962259019f70af86f180bf8f153c6c11d73019a44dbb8a5bb4151688e9e99:1
  • value  11069731
    address  3BMEXrFu7GWmUHzVmzTXzUX8z8sATZWNpS